gpt4 book ai didi

java - java ' assert ' 和 ' if () {} else exit;' 之间的区别

转载 作者:塔克拉玛干 更新时间:2023-11-03 04:42:54 29 4
gpt4 key购买 nike

java assertif () {} else exit; 有什么区别?

我可以只使用 if () {} else exit 而不是 assert 吗?

最佳答案

也许有点谷歌?

"你应该记住的主要事情是 if-else 语句应该用于程序流控制,而 assert 关键字应该只用于测试目的。你不应该使用断言来实际执行程序所需的任何操作您的应用程序才能正常工作。根据 Sun 的官方 Java 文档:“每个断言都包含一个 boolean 表达式,您相信断言执行时该表达式为真。” "

阅读更多:http://wiki.answers.com/Q/What_is_the_difference_between_assert_keyword_and_if_keyword_in_java#ixzz1v2GGfAhq

关于java - java ' assert ' 和 ' if () {} else exit;' 之间的区别,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10618582/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com